About this sunscreen
Solbar Zinc SPF 38 is a long-lasting sunscreen that combines mineral Zinc Oxide with chemical Ethylhexyl Methoxycinnamate and Homosalate. It wears with a balanced finish, feels lightweight, and is low on breakout risk, though the zinc content can leave a moderate white cast. The filter set is older-generation, and with good protection it scores 68.1/100.

Does Solbar Zinc SPF 38 leave a white cast?
It can leave a moderate white cast, in part from the Zinc Oxide. The finish is balanced, but the cast is worth noting on deeper skin tones.
Is the Solbar Zinc SPF38 Long Lasting Sunscreen good?
It scores 68.1/100, a mid-tier result. It offers good protection and a lightweight balanced finish, though the older filter set and moderate cast keep it from rating higher.
Is it mineral or chemical?
It is a hybrid, combining mineral Zinc Oxide with chemical Ethylhexyl Methoxycinnamate and Homosalate.
